Diagnosis

The diagnosis of ADHD is a challenging and long-winded process. The first step is to schedule an appointment with a mental health professional who will evaluate the symptoms you are experiencing and give you the diagnosis.

There is a long waitlist for an evaluation, so it is crucial to seek the appropriate help as quickly as you can. There are many options available, including medication or therapy as well as support groups.

ADHD symptoms can show up in the early years of childhood. If you suspect that you may have ADHD Your doctor may suggest an appointment with a psychiatrist who is specialized in neurodevelopmental disorders such as ADHD.

A referral could be made to a Private Adhd assessment manchester clinic such as Priory. To determine whether ADHD is the reason, a specialist will examine your lifestyle and the way you live.

Adults who suffer from ADHD are more likely to exhibit different symptoms than children. Adults with ADHD may experience difficulties with concentration and memory. They may have difficulty completing tasks and completing schoolwork, as well as working in the workplace.

Additionally, they could be struggling with relationships and managing work and family. They may also be suffering from depression, anxiety or other mental health issues.

If you're looking for a psychiatrist in Manchester to visit for an evaluation, it is vital to seek a doctor who has extensive experience in treating neurodevelopmental disorders like ADHD. This is an essential step in diagnosing your condition since the doctor will be able to provide you with a treatment plan based on their experience and knowledge.

The psychiatrist will determine if you suffer from ADHD and what you can do to treat it. They will also provide information on the various treatment options and how to access them.

They'll also be able of referring you to a group or an individual therapy session, private adhd Assessment manchester and provide information on self-help resources. They will be able to explain the various treatments for ADHD to assist you in making informed choices regarding the treatment you choose and which one is best for you.

Medication

ADHD is a common disorder that affects people of all ages. It is treatable by taking medication, diet supplements, or treatment for behavioral issues.

Medication is an essential component of treatment for ADHD and can help with many aspects of the disorder. This includes reducing hyperactivity and improving concentration. This can help your child to learn better and be more focused on their studies. It can also help with social skills.

One of the most frequently prescribed treatments for ADHD is methylphenidate. The drug boosts brain activity and affects regions of the brain that control the behavior and attention. It is available in capsule, tablet and liquid form.

Another option for treating ADHD is the atomoxetine. It's a non-stimulant medication and can be used in situations where stimulant medication isn't working or cause unacceptable side effects.

This medication is taken regularly and is often used with other therapies, such as cognitive behavioral therapy. It may take several weeks for the medication to show any indications of ADHD. Regular use is recommended.

Some people who suffer from severe ADHD may require more intense treatment that includes a range of medications. These include lithium, atomoxetine and sertraline.

The medications are prescribed by a specialist and must be monitored closely to make sure they are functioning exactly as they should. A patient will typically need to attend between three and four follow-up appointments prior to when they can be prescribed medication. Patients should also see their doctor at least once a year to ensure that they are correctly and safely taking their medication.

Rejection sensitivity

Rejection sensitive dysphoria (RSD) is an illness that causes severe emotional distress when you experience feelings of failure or rejection. This intense emotional response is unlike any other kind of pain, and can cause severe anxiety, panic, or distress.

While there isn't a known reason behind RSD Experts have linked it to mental health disorders like neurotic characteristics. Although it is most common in those with ADHD, it can also occur in people without the condition.

RSD is usually associated with intense emotional pain. It can be triggered by a variety of causes like feeling unloved or not being able to meet others' expectations.

This sensitivity could lead to long-term mental health problems and behavioral changes, as well as anxiety about failure that affect the lives of children as well as adults. It can also affect the ability to develop healthy relationships and careers.

There are many treatments that can be used to treat RSD. While medication is the most frequently used treatment but nutritional supplements and behavioral therapy are also available.

Certain people with RSD might need therapy to uncover negative thinking patterns that lead them to feel rejection. They can also learn strategies to break out of negative cycles that have been created over time because of their heightened sensitivity to rejection.

If you suspect you have RSD If you think you might have RSD, speak with your GP about an appointment with an expert. They will look at your mental health and ADHD symptoms along with other conditions to determine the diagnosis.

Following your assessment your doctor will recommend an appropriate treatment plan for you. These treatments could include medication or other therapies. Other tests could be performed to confirm that there is no medical issues.
